== Translation ==
Gem labels: Cold, Gravity, Pain, Heat, Wind

The cut and type of the
gem determines what kind of
spren are attracted to it
and can be imprisoned in it.
There must be thousands of viable combinations.

Flamespren trapped in Emerald

[[Pain Knife]]

Removable outer covering
to infuse fabrial with
Stormlight.

[[Fabrial]]

Once a spren is captured and the
gem infused with Stormlight the
fabrial can be used in machines.
The pain knife is used
as a means of protection.
Sharp blades pierce an
attacker's clothing and
cause crippling pain.

Retractable blades cause crippling pain.

Dial pushes blades to four set lengths.
